The story of Dragon Ball begins in the mountains, where the wise fighting master Son Gohan stumbles upon a strange boy whom he names Son Goku. Gohan takes Goku under his wing and teaches him the ways of martial arts, becoming a father figure to the young boy. When Gohan passes away, Goku is left to fend for himself, but his natural strength and determination serve him well.

One day, Goku's life takes an unexpected turn when he meets Bulma, a teenage girl who is on a quest to find all seven of the mystical Dragon Balls. These powerful artifacts are said to grant the user one wish, and Bulma is determined to use them to make her dreams come true. Together, Goku and Bulma set out on an epic journey to find all seven Dragon Balls, encountering a host of memorable characters and overcoming countless obstacles along the way.

Throughout their adventure, Goku and Bulma form a strong bond of friendship, and Goku learns the true meaning of compassion and empathy. As they search for the Dragon Balls, Goku also discovers his own hidden powers and becomes a formidable fighter in his own right.
